Transaction 762568dbe94da06f643c3854ae9fc791524bb0f1e5af7b4524fe68143cac2072
1 Input
1 Output
-
762568dbe94da06f643c3854ae9fc791524bb0f1e5af7b4524fe68143cac2072:0
- value
- 344941
- script pubkey
- OP_0 OP_PUSHBYTES_20 fba6e5d35244a5c47538291ec340dd9b4f2259fd
- address
- bc1qlwnwt56jgjjugafc9y0vxsxand8jyk0a5rh4vn